## Authentication

Load tests against the Cartwheel checkout flow run through the internal GateRunner service, which mints short-lived shopper sessions so we don't hammer the real identity provider. Release managers should schedule runs only against the `perf-east` cluster; production endpoints reject GateRunner tokens outright. Configure the harness with the target environment and concurrency cap first. GateRunner itself authenticates every run request, so the harness config must include the key shown below.

API key for tagug-tajef: vxb4-R1fo

**CI note — Gallerio audio-guide app**

Heads up: the Gallerio pipeline keeps failing at the asset-bundling step because the narration files for the Fennwick Hall exhibit exceed the cache limit. Workaround is to clear the runner cache and rerun — takes about six minutes. The first green run after the cache purge is the one referenced below.

pipeline stamp: htk4_ae36

Test plan: color-contrast audit for the Larkspur dashboard redesign. We will run automated contrast checks against every themed component, then manually verify edge cases like disabled buttons, placeholder text, and the muted chart legends. Pass threshold is WCAG AA for body text and AA-large for headings. Please confirm the fixture list covers both dark and high-contrast modes before approving. The audit runner hits the Larkspur theming API on staging, which requires authentication for each batch request.

portal login ticket: eyJhbGciOiJIUzI1NiIsInR5cCI6IkpXVCJ9.eyJzdWIiOiIMjvRAf3PEFIn0.nuv9gjixLtnr

**Handover — PickPath Optimizer (Darya → Collum)**

Batch solver stable. Route-scoring regression from last sprint fixed; see changelog. Open items: zone-merge heuristic still over-weights cold storage, and the nightly re-index sometimes stalls on the Harwick depot dataset. Staging creds rotate Friday. If the optimizer config store locks you out mid-rotation (it did to me twice), recovery mode needs manual auth. Enter the recovery passphrase shown on the next line.

strongbox words: ulaael-caswyn